Description |
English: A silver soldino of a Venician Doge, AD1367-1423, probably Michele Steno AD1400-1413. Obverse shows Doge left holding banner, star with I below. Obverse legend reads: [...]TE[...]. Obverse legend probably originally read [MIChAEL S]TE[NO DVX]. Reverse shows Winged and nimbate lion of St Mark facing within a circle and holding book of gospels. Reverse legend reads: +S.M[AR]CVS.VE[NE]TI.
Die axis is 10 o'clock, weight is 0.37g, diameter is 15.18mm, thickness is 0.35mm. |
